JFAC approves trailer appropriations to match commissioner pay change in SB1148
Summary
The committee approved trailer appropriations to implement pay adjustments for commissioners at the Public Utilities Commission, Industrial Commission and State Tax Commission required by SB1148.

The Joint Finance-Appropriations Committee approved trailer appropriations to implement salary adjustments for several state commissioners following statutory changes in Senate Bill 1148.
Committee analysts explained that SB1148 amended state law to provide an increase in commissioner compensation tied to a compensation-equity component (CEC) applied to other state employees. Because those commissioners are outside the general CEC process, the committee considered separate appropriations to align their pay adjustments.
Committee motions provided appropriations to three agencies. The committee voted to add $11,800 from dedicated funds for the Public Utilities Commission; to add $15,700 split between general and dedicated funds for the State Tax Commission ($13,000 general fund and $2,700 dedicated; total $15,700); and to add $11,800 from dedicated funds for the Industrial Commission. Each motion was moved and seconded on the floor and was recorded as passing with majority support in the committee delegations present; committee staff summarized the vote totals and issued due-pass recommendations.
Committee members noted the statutory requirement that commissioner pay adjustments be handled separately from the broader CEC process. The funding amounts were described as limited-dollar adjustments to reflect salary and associated benefit increases.
